The Statler Brothers stepped out from behind the shadow of Johnny Cash (they toured and recorded with the country star throughout the '60s and into the early '70s) and became one of the most beloved singing groups in country history during their long stay with Mercury Records. This 12-disc collection brings together the group's biggest hits from this time period, including "Flowers on the Wall," "Bed of Rose's," "Susan When She Tried," and "Charlotte's Web," among others, making this a nice introduction to the Statler Brothers' secular side. ~ Steve Leggett
